What is the domain of the rational function f(x) = 2x2-7/ 3x + 5?


A. the set of all positive real numbers

B. the set of all real numbers except x= - 5/3

C. the set of all real numbers

D. the set of all real numbers except x= 5/3

Solution.


f(x)=2x273x+5f(x)=\frac{2x^2-7}{3x+5}

Domain:

3x+50,x53.3x+5\neq 0,\newline x\neq -\frac{5}{3}.

Answer. B
